Resumo

This video celebrates five 1980s films that shaped the childhood of a rough-and-tumble Brazilian generation: 'Tipo Lá Fora,' 'E.T.,' 'Os Goonies,' 'Deu a Louca nos Monstros,' and 'A História Sem Fim.' The creator humorously reframes these classics as traumatic, chaotic, and formative experiences that contrast sharply with modern parenting and entertainment standards. Through colorful storytelling and production trivia, the video argues that these films—and the unsupervised, physically rough childhoods they accompanied—built character in ways contemporary media cannot.

Público-alvo: Brazilian millennials and Gen X viewers who grew up in the 1980s and seek nostalgic, humorous commentary on formative films from their childhood, combined with anyone interested in film history and generational culture.
